Artist Biography:
Award winning artist, Roberta Remy attended Parsons School of
Design, The School of Visual Arts and The Art Students League of New York,
where she studied painting, drawing an d anatomy. Many years of study with
renowned painters has been a major influence in perfecting this artist’s
impressive technique, style, and motivation; all of which have played a part in
her success as a painter. Remy’s work has been included in numerous juried and
invitational shows including the Salmagundi Club, OPA and the Albuquerque Museum
and is held in corporate and private collections throughout the US, Brazil and
Europe.
A contemporary painter working the realist tradition, Roberta
derives inspiration from the old masters and the American Impressionists.
Previously a New York based illustrator, she now makes Santa Fe home base where
she’s been expanding her teaching activities since 1995. She says “When I teach
my students now, I remember the wonderful and generous instructors I’ve been
fortunate to have. I try to follow that tradition and pass it
on”.
